Find the value of m which satisfies \(\left(\dfrac{22}{5}\right)^{18} \times \left(\dfrac{5}{22}\right)^{8} \times \left(\dfrac{22}{5}\right)^{6} = \left(\dfrac{5}{22}\right)^{9m+4}.\)
\(-\dfrac{20}{9}\)
Left side: \(\left(\dfrac{22}{5}\right)^{18}\times\left(\dfrac{5}{22}\right)^{8}\times\left(\dfrac{22}{5}\right)^{6} = \left(\dfrac{22}{5}\right)^{18+6}\times\left(\dfrac{22}{5}\right)^{-8} = \left(\dfrac{22}{5}\right)^{16}\).
Right side: \(\left(\dfrac{5}{22}\right)^{9m+4} = \left(\dfrac{22}{5}\right)^{-(9m+4)}\).
Equating exponents: \(16 = -(9m+4) \Rightarrow 9m+4 = -16 \Rightarrow 9m = -20 \Rightarrow m = -\dfrac{20}{9}\).
Hence, the value of m is \(-\tfrac{20}{9}\).
